在信息技术飞速发展的今天,互联网已成为连接全球用户的重要桥梁,而虚拟主机技术作为这一领域的核心支撑之一,正以其独特的优势推动着网络服务的革新与升级,本文旨在深入探讨虚拟主机技术的原理、优势、应用场景以及未来发展趋势,为读者揭示这一技术在数字时代中的关键作用。
云服之家,国内最专业的云服务器虚拟主机域名商家信息平台
虚拟主机技术概述
虚拟主机技术,简而言之,是一种将物理服务器资源分割成多个独立虚拟服务器的技术,每个虚拟主机都拥有自己独立的操作系统、存储空间、内存和带宽资源,能够像实体服务器一样运行各种应用程序和服务,而无需共享硬件资源,这种技术的核心优势在于提高了资源利用率、降低了成本,并增强了服务器的灵活性和可管理性。
技术原理
虚拟主机技术基于虚拟化技术实现,其中最著名的两种技术是VMware的vSphere和Microsoft的Hyper-V,这些平台通过软件层(称为“虚拟机管理程序”或“Hypervisor”)在单个物理服务器上创建、隔离和管理多个操作系统实例,每个虚拟机(VM)都拥有自己的一套硬件资源,包括CPU、内存、硬盘等,这些资源通过虚拟化层进行抽象和分配,实现了资源的灵活调度和高效利用。
优势分析
- 成本效益:相比传统的物理服务器部署,虚拟主机技术显著降低了硬件投资成本,企业可以根据实际需求动态调整资源,避免资源浪费,同时降低了维护和升级成本。
- 高可用性:通过虚拟化,企业可以轻松实现应用的备份、迁移和灾难恢复,提高了服务的连续性和可靠性。
- 灵活性:虚拟主机可以快速部署和配置,支持快速扩展和缩减资源,适应不断变化的业务需求。
- 资源优化:虚拟化环境允许更精细的资源管理,如CPU和内存的按需分配,提高了整体性能。
- 隔离性与安全性:每个虚拟主机都是隔离的,即使一个虚拟机出现问题也不会影响到其他虚拟机,增强了系统的安全性和稳定性。
应用场景
- 网站托管:对于小型企业和个人开发者而言,虚拟主机是托管网站经济的选择,它提供了快速部署、易于管理的环境,支持多种编程语言和技术栈。
- 云计算平台:作为云计算基础设施的一部分,虚拟主机技术支撑了SaaS(软件即服务)、PaaS(平台即服务)和IaaS(基础设施即服务)的提供。
- 灾难恢复:通过创建虚拟机快照和复制,实现数据的快速恢复,确保业务连续性。
- 测试与开发环境:开发者可以在虚拟环境中快速搭建测试环境,模拟各种生产条件,提高开发效率和代码质量。
- 大数据分析:在大数据处理中,虚拟主机可以灵活分配计算资源,支持大规模数据处理和分析任务。
未来趋势与挑战
尽管虚拟主机技术已经取得了显著成就,但其未来发展仍面临一些挑战和机遇,随着容器化技术(如Docker)和Kubernetes等编排工具的兴起,容器化部署成为新的趋势,它提供了更轻量、更高效的部署方式,边缘计算、5G网络的普及对低延迟、高带宽的需求将推动虚拟主机技术向更高效的资源管理和更广泛的分布式部署方向发展。
安全性仍然是虚拟主机技术必须重视的问题,随着网络攻击手段的不断进化,加强虚拟化环境下的安全防护措施,如实施多层防御体系、定期安全审计和漏洞扫描等,成为保障数据安全的关键。
虚拟主机技术作为现代网络基础设施的重要组成部分,不仅极大地提升了资源利用效率和服务灵活性,还为企业和个人用户提供了更加高效、安全、经济的解决方案,面对未来技术的不断演进和挑战,持续创新和完善将是推动虚拟主机技术发展的关键,我们有理由相信,在不久的将来,虚拟主机技术将在更多领域发挥重要作用,为数字经济的繁荣贡献力量。